Typical Issues with Bi-Fold Doors
Bi-fold doors are comprised of numerous panels that fold together when opened or closed. They are typically mounted on a track system that enables them to move efficiently. Nevertheless, gradually, the doors can become misaligned, the tracks can end up being clogged, and the hinges can wear out. Here are some typical concerns that can take place with bi-fold doors:
Misaligned doorsSticky or jammed doorsDamaged hinges or rollersBroken or harmed panelsMalfunctioning locking mechanisms

Step-by-Step Guide to Bi-Fold Door Repair
Here are some step-by-step guides on how to repair typical problems with bi-fold doors:
1. Repairing Misaligned Doors
Misaligned doors can be brought on by loose hinges, unequal tracks, or distorted panels. Here's how to repair them:
Check the hinges and tighten up any loose screws.Inspect the tracks and clear out any debris or dust.Adjust the rollers or hinges to make sure correct alignment.If the panels are deformed, think about changing them.2. Fixing Sticky or Jammed Doors
Sticky or jammed doors can be brought on by broken rollers, misaligned tracks, or excessive dust accumulation. Here's how to repair them:
Clean out any particles or dust from the tracks and rollers.Apply lube to the rollers or hinges.Examine the positioning of the tracks and adjust them if essential.If the rollers are used out, think about changing them.3. Replacing Worn Out Hinges or Rollers
Run-down hinges or rollers can trigger the doors to end up being misaligned or sticky. Here's how to replace them:
Remove the old hinges or rollers and clean the area.Apply lubricant to the new hinges or rollers.Install the brand-new hinges or rollers and tighten any loose screws.Check the doors to make sure correct alignment and smooth operation.4. Fixing Broken or Damaged Panels
Broken or damaged panels can be triggered by accidents, weather condition damage, or wear and tear. Here's how to fix them:

Preventative Maintenance for Bi-Fold Doors
To prevent common problems with bi-fold doors, it's important to carry out regular maintenance jobs. Here are some ideas:
Clean the tracks and rollers regularly to prevent dust accumulation.Lube the hinges and rollers to make sure smooth operation.Examine the positioning of the doors and adjust them if necessary.Check the locking system and replace any broken parts.
